Pro Bono Coaching in Management

The past two years have been challenging in many ways and have greatly impacted civil society organisations’ finances, mission, work development, internal functioning…

Individual conversations we had with members of the network concluded that many are confronted with management issues : How to effectively exercise leadership and maintain team cohesion and performance in a context of increasing uncertainties and generalized remote work ? How can I ensure that my organisation’s actions are still well aligned with its mission and objectives ? How to accomodate participatory practices with effective and embodied leadership ? How to better manage volunteers ?

To empower the community around these questions, we are happy to announce that we have partnered with Chapters.fr, a consultancy specialized in Management trainings and coaching, who will kindly offer to 3 CFEU members pro bono tailor-made coaching sessions to exchange on their management challenges and equip them with concrete and actionable solutions.
